IHB's Project Granted 2nd Prize of 2012 S&T Award for Environmental Protection

The Ministry of Environmental Protection recently announced the results of winners that are granted with the 2012 S&T Award for Environmental Protection. The project “Mechanisms and integrative technology for water pollution control of urban rivers and lakes”, primarily undertaken by Institute of Hydrobiology, Chinese Academy of Sciences, was granted with the 2nd prize of the 2012 S&T Award for Environmental Protection.  

Delving into the serious water pollution problems of urban rivers and lakes during the rapid urbanization in China, the project team analyzed the characteristics of urban river pollution and elucidated the 8 basic features in environmental ecology of urban rivers and lakes, based on which, they had a comparative study on both the common and unique features of urban rivers and lakes in the middle and lower reaches of Yangtze River and Pearl River. For the first time, they elucidated the mechanisms underlying the control of urban river pollution and proposed an approach that can control the internally and externally generated pollutants by shifting location. By resorting to the technologies applied in environmental engineering and ecological restoration, the project team also developed technologies related to river diversion and the avoiding of river peak flow, impelling of aeration, fixation of sediment by organisms, and safe spreading of local ecological microorganisms in water bodies and restoration of vegetation etc.  

The project has realized the improvement of the sediments and water quality of urban rivers and lakes and restored their ecosystems. So far, the technology has been promoted and applied in Hubei, Shanghai, Yunnan and Guangdong, generating evident environmental and ecological benefits.
